Movin’ on Down…Ivanka Trump Takes Store From Madison to Mercer
Ivanka Trump, haute 100 lister, member of two of New York’s most prestigious real estate families, and jewelry designer in her own right, moved her Madison Avenue jewelry store from its Uptown location to Mercer Street in SoHo. With the move downtown comes a complimenting shift in design; the designer unveiled her new Downtown Collection, which showcases younger and trendier pieces. The Downtown line ranges in price and style, from a stacked pearl ring ($650) to a diamond-encrusted ebony cuff ($3,600). The new store boasts one-of-a-kind couture pieces, a bridal salon, a bar and a lounge and a private shopping room–containing the brand’s debuting line of luxury timepieces, leather ware and accessories.
